Katy and Ed are a gorgeous British couple living in sunny Dubai. Having friends coming from all over the world, they decided that they wanted a destination wedding in a place that would be central to all and give everyone a chance to enjoy a break in a unique destination while celebrating with them. As Katy has Italian origin, she opted for Puglia, Italy. Her search for a destination wedding planner proved to be harder than she expected. She encountered a couple of planners that claimed they didn’t take commissions, but as she was able to contact venues directly, she realised that the prices the planners were giving her were inflated. Disappointed by the experience, she almost gave up with the idea of a destination wedding in Italy, until she came across the UKAWP and then me. I’ll never forget her first email and our first Skype! I had reassure her that the whole not taking commissions was actual true, as she had completely lost faith in wedding planners.
“Since childhood, I wanted a wedding in Italy, where my grandmother was from,” says Katy. “The wedding of my dreams took place in a venue with archways and a staircase, and was whitewashed, or light in colour.” With this in mind, Castello Marchione fit the bill perfectly. “Even seeing it in the distance when we viewed it gave me goosebumps,” Katy says. “As we stepped out of the car I burst into tears of happiness. It was beautiful and we fixed our date then and there.” Living in Hong Kong, planning a wedding in Puglia and inviting guests from all over the world was a bit of a logistical challenge, but Katy and Edward hired destination wedding planner Elisabetta White to make sure everything went smoothly. “She was incredible; I would never have had the fairy-tale wedding without her. We didn’t have to worry about anything on our wedding day, and we were able to relax and enjoy every moment.”









Katy’s advice have for other brides-to-be planning a destination wedding is to take extra time to work out logistics for guests, and be as helpful and knowledgeable about the local area as you can, particularly if guests are travelling outside of their comfort zone. Also she recommends not to be disheartened if some people don’t make it, and also embrace the traditions of your location rather than getting caught up trying to stick with home traditions because they’re familiar.
